Brittani Beauford, 30, was killed while outside a vehicle on the transition road from the northbound San Diego (405) Freeway to the northbound San Gabriel River (605) Freeway in Los Alamitos, authorities said Saturday.
Beauford had been in a car accident and got out of a vehicle on the transition road when she was fatally struck, Supervising Orange County Deputy Coroner E. Arellano said. Beauford’s city of residence was not available, Arellano said.
The pedestrian accident was reported at 11:55 p.m. Friday.
